TV star Shweta Tiwari, known for her resilience, has faced many challenges in her personal life, including two broken marriages. Despite all hardships, she has raised her children single-handedly. Recently, an emotional story from Shweta’s past resurfaced, showing the impact of her troubled marriage on her daughter, Palak Tiwari.
Troubled Times: Shweta’s First Marriage and Impact on Palak
Shweta Tiwari’s first marriage with actor Raja Chaudhary ended on a sour note after nine years. The actress had accused Raja of physical abuse, making life difficult not only for herself but also for her young daughter, Palak. During this turbulent period, balancing work and motherhood became overwhelming for Shweta.
Palak was only two years old at that time, and the toxic environment at home began affecting her health. The constant arguments and chaos would terrify the little girl, leading to severe asthma attacks. Doctors advised that Palak needed to stay in a calm environment, ideally somewhere far from the stressful household. However, Shweta struggled to find a way to manage her work commitments and care for her daughter simultaneously.
Palak’s Emotional Outburst: “Will You Leave Me Forever?”
In a heartfelt interview, Shweta Tiwari shared how difficult it was to send Palak to her in-laws for a short period, hoping it would improve her health. However, being away from her mother only made Palak more anxious. Watching her mother on television made things worse.
At that time, Shweta was playing a mother in the popular TV show Kasautii Zindagii Kay. In the show, her character shared a close bond with her on-screen child, Prem. Seeing this love on television left young Palak feeling insecure and afraid.
“One day, she broke down crying,” Shweta recalled. “Palak asked me, ‘Will you leave me and never come back?’” This emotional plea deeply affected Shweta, and she decided to bring Palak back home, despite the challenges.
